Does Sker Ritual Have Crossplay?
The good news is that Sker Ritual has crossplay. However, before you get too excited, the game only supports crossplay between PC and Xbox devices. This restriction means you cannot play with your friends who own the game on PlayStation (or vice versa if you play on a PlayStation console).
In addition, crossplay is only possible through random matchmaking, which you must enable in your Networking Options menu, meaning it is not currently possible to create a private party or invite players from other platforms. This is the reason why you only see your friend’s list from your platform. Otherwise, you can have up to four players per match from supported crossplay devices.
Unfortunately, the developers have not released any information on why this is the case or if they will add PlayStation crossplay support so all players can play with each other regardless of which platform they purchase the game.
